"<ul> \
<li style='font-weight: bold;'> \
Projected Qty = Actual Qty + Planned Qty + Requested Qty \
+ Ordered Qty - Reserved Qty </li> \
<ul> \
<li>Actual Qty: Quantity available in the warehouse. </li> \
<li>Planned Qty: Quantity, for which, Production Order has been raised, \
but is pending to be manufactured. </li> \
<li>Requested Qty: Quantity requested for purchase, but not ordered. </li> \
<li>Ordered Qty: Quantity ordered for purchase, but not received.</li> \
<li>Reserved Qty: Quantity ordered for sale, but not delivered. </li> \
</ul> \
</ul>");
